Hope this is an okay place to put this. Ended up with an aiptasia and picked up a peppermint to battle it, as I was losing the battle with lemon juice/vinegar. That's when I noticed this new anemone looking thing. I tried to get a picture, but unfortunately my camera won't get me in close enough and I can't seem to get the white balance right. Anyway, I've circled it and will do my best to describe it. This anemone is a little smaller than a dime. It has a translucent body with sparse tiny white spots and a pinkish mouth area. There could be as many as a couple dozen tentacles each with a white dot at the end. Any helped anyone can provide would be awesome. Sorry for the poor pic quality. Working on it.
